Andy Cohen Confirms That RHOBH Was Originally Going to be a Show About the Richards Sisters!

For years rumors have swirled that the Real Housewives of Beverly Hills was initially set to be a reality TV show following Kathy Hilton and her sister Kim and Kyle Richards.

Rumor has it, Kathy, backed out of the show leaving the network scratching their heads. With Kim and Kyle still signed on the reality TV show was eventually developed into the Real Housewives of Beverly Hills.

This tidbit of news was purely an old wives tale for over a decade that is until the June 9th episode of Watch What Happens Live With Andy Cohen.

On Wednesday, Andy confirmed that RHOBH was originally going to be a show about the Richards sisters.

Andy said, “The Real Housewives of Beverly Hills almost didn’t happen. It was almost a show around Kim, Kathy, and Kyle.”

Kyle and Kim starred on RHOBH from its debut in 2010. Kim starred on the show from season 1 thru 5. She appeared as a guest for seasons 7 thru 10. Kyle remains the only “OG” Housewife to remain on the franchise. During season 11, Kathy joined the franchise as a friend of the Housewives.

The Real Housewives of Beverly Hills airs on Wednesdays at 9 p.m. ET/PT on Bravo.
